Mike Sanjuan Los Angeles, California

This music is about portraying the most honest of human emotions. Lyrically, the music is personal and from the heart. Its about the stuff that ails you when nobody is around. Currently in its folk rock form, the project uses melodies from blues and jazz roots, but adds a modern twist. ... more
